Universal buys 'Villains' comic book
Published Wednesday, Oct 29 2008, 16:27 GMT | By Simon Reynolds
Universal has secured the movie rights to forthcoming Viper Comics graphic novel Villains.
The comic, by Adam Cogan and Ryan Cody, ignores costumed heroes to focus on antagonistic supervillains.
The movie will show how an unsuccessful young man finds renewed purpose when he meets a Svengali-like villain who becomes his mentor, says The Hollywood Reporter.
Matt Jennison and Brent Strickland, who are currently working on Warner Bros's long-awaited Wonder Woman project, will pen the Villains adaptation.
